为什么FileAppender没有锁定文件?

时间:2019-10-17 14:26:21

标签: java spring-boot logback spring-logback

logback出现问题。在下面找到一个logback.xml文件。 每个线程都有一个日志文件。但是,无法通过查看文件来识别文件已完成或线程已完成。文件未锁定或其他原因。我不想编写代码来获取文件的内容,我的意思是,不想编写一些符号来查找文件已完成。我已经搜索了3个月:) 我希望你能帮助我。 非常感谢。

 <appender name="SIFT" class="XXXXX.SiftingAppender">
    <discriminator>
        <key>fileLocation</key>
        <defaultValue>${user.home}\start.log</defaultValue>
    </discriminator>
    <sift>
        <appender name="FILE-${fileLocation}" class="ch.qos.logback.core.FileAppender">
            <file>${fileLocation}</file>
            <append>false</append>
            <encoder>
                <pattern>%msg%n</pattern>
            </encoder>
        </appender>
    </sift>
</appender>

0 个答案:

没有答案
相关问题